T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model belongs to the field of environmental protection technology, more particularly to dust-containing gas trapping system. BACKGROUND

[0002] In the field of environmental protection technology, the effective trapping of dust-containing gas is a key link in industrial production to ensure the normal operation of equipment, reduce environmental pollution and avoid safety risks. At present, in the process of industrial production (such as calcium sulfide production, anhydrous hydrogen fluoride production and silane gas related inorganic material process), solid feeding is easy to produce dust, and the dust particle size is extremely small in some scenes (such as calcium sulfide production, calcium hydroxide powder particle size is about 10 μm), which leads to the low separation efficiency of traditional cyclone separation equipment for fine components, and it is difficult to effectively trap dust. These uncollected dust is easy to enter the subsequent vacuum pipeline or unit, causing pipeline blockage, equipment damage and affecting production continuity; at the same time, in the production of anhydrous hydrogen fluoride, the dust content of the reaction furnace slag tail gas is high, and the existing dust removal system often cannot realize efficient purification, and a large amount of dust emission will cause serious environmental pollution; in addition, for special materials such as silane gas, it is easy to burn when discharged into the air, which has the risk of backfire explosion, and the traditional low-pressure state of the flame arrester and other facilities cannot effectively prevent backfire, and cannot realize synchronous dust collection, which cannot meet the environmental protection requirements and cannot guarantee the production safety. Furthermore, the existing part of the water washing dust removal system lacks precise liquid level control and pressure balance mechanism, which is easy to cause dust secondary escape due to bubbles, liquid level fluctuation affects dust removal effect and other problems, which further reduces the stability and reliability of dust-containing gas trapping. Therefore, an efficient dust-containing gas trapping system is needed, which can effectively trap fine dust, meet environmental protection and safety requirements, and has stable control function, to solve the problems of the prior art. [0011] The dust-containing gas capturing system works as follows:

[0012] Firstly, the washing liquid (such as dilute ammonia water) is injected into the primary water washing tank and the secondary water washing tank through the washing liquid supply pipeline until the liquid level meter monitors that the preset appropriate liquid level is reached, at which time the on-off valves on the washing liquid pipelines are closed. Then, the vacuum pipeline connected with the demister is opened to perform vacuumizing operation, so that the interiors of the primary water washing tank, the secondary water washing tank and the demister are maintained in the required vacuum state; at the same time, the bottom valves of the temporary storage tank connected to the bottom exhaust outlets of the primary water washing tank, the secondary water washing tank and the demister are kept in the open state, and since the interiors of the water washing tanks and the demister are in vacuum, a pressure difference is formed with the temporary storage tank, so that the washing liquid liquid level in the tank is kept stable and does not fall.

[0013] When the reaction equipment operates to generate a dust-containing gas phase, the gas phase enters a first-stage water washing tank through a gas phase outlet of the reaction equipment, because the gas phase pipeline outlet in the first-stage water washing tank extends below the liquid level of the washing liquid, the dust-containing gas directly rushes into the washing liquid, and most of the dust is adsorbed by the washing liquid; at the same time, the sawtooth-shaped breaking structure at the pipeline outlet can effectively break the gas bubbles generated in the washing liquid, so as to avoid the bubbles from carrying the un-adsorbed dust to escape again into the gas phase space. After the gas phase is washed in the first stage, the gas phase enters a second-stage water washing tank through a gas phase pipeline, and the second-stage water washing tank has the same structural design as the first-stage water washing tank. The gas phase rushes into the washing liquid again to be deeply purified, so as to further remove residual dust. After the gas phase is washed in two stages, the gas phase then enters a mist eliminator, in which the water mist carried in the gas phase is removed, so as to ensure that the gas phase entering the subsequent vacuum system is dry, and to avoid the influence of the water mist on the vacuum system.

[0014] During the system operation, the liquid level meters on the first-stage water washing tank, the second-stage water washing tank, the mist eliminator and the temporary storage tank monitor the liquid levels in real time, and transmit data to the control system. When the liquid level in the first-stage water washing tank, the second-stage water washing tank or the mist eliminator rises to a preset upper limit due to dust adsorption, gas phase carrying of a small amount of liquid and other factors, the control system immediately interlocks to open the on-off valve on the balance gas pipeline, so as to realize vacuum breaking by connecting the balance gas pipeline, so that the pressure in the tank is restored to close to normal pressure, and the liquid level in the tank is lowered. When the liquid level meter detects that the liquid level is below the upper limit, the control system interlocks to close the on-off valve, and the tanks are maintained in a vacuum state again. If the liquid level in the first-stage water washing tank or the second-stage water washing tank decreases to a preset lower limit due to washing liquid loss and other reasons, the control system interlocks to open the on-off valve on the washing liquid pipeline of the corresponding tank, so as to supplement the washing liquid through the washing liquid supply pipeline, until the liquid level rises to an appropriate liquid level, and then the on-off valve is closed. For the temporary storage tank, when the liquid level meter detects that the waste liquid (washing liquid containing dust) collected in the temporary storage tank reaches the upper limit, the control system starts the delivery pump at the outlet of the temporary storage tank, so as to deliver the temporary storage liquid to the downstream recovery section for resource recycling, so as to avoid overflow of the temporary storage tank. In addition, the first-stage water washing tank and the second-stage water washing tank are also provided with sight glasses, through which the operator can observe the state of the washing liquid in the tank. When it is observed that the washing liquid becomes a suspension due to adsorption of a large amount of dust, and the adsorption capacity is reduced, the suspension can be manually controlled to be discharged to the temporary storage tank, and then new washing liquid is injected through the washing liquid supply pipeline, so as to ensure the water washing and purification effect.

[0030] When working, the specific process is as follows:

[0031] Taking the dust-containing gas capturing in the production process of calcium thiosulfate as an example, first, according to the production process requirements of calcium thiosulfate, the washing liquid is determined to be dilute ammonia water, the dilute ammonia water is injected into the first water washing tank 1 and the second water washing tank 2 through the washing liquid supply pipeline 5, and the liquid level meters 10 on the tank bodies are observed at the same time, when the liquid level reaches the preset height (ensuring that the gas phase pipeline outlet is inserted below the liquid surface by 300 mm), the on-off valves 11 on the washing liquid pipelines of the first water washing tank 1 and the second water washing tank 2 are closed. Then, the vacuum pipeline 6 connected with the demister 3 is opened, the vacuum system is started to perform vacuumizing, and the interiors of the first water washing tank 1, the second water washing tank 2 and the demister 3 are maintained at a vacuum degree of 0.06 MPa, at this time, the bottom valves of the temporary storage tank 7 connected with the bottom exhaust outlets of the first water washing tank 1, the second water washing tank 2 and the demister 3 are kept open, the liquid level of the dilute ammonia water in the first water washing tank 1 and the second water washing tank 2 is stabilized by the pressure difference between the internal vacuum and the temporary storage tank 7, and the dilute ammonia water liquid level does not fall.

[0032] Subsequently, the calcium thiosulfate production equipment began to run, the hydrogen oxide calcium dust (particle size of about 10 μm) generated during the feeding process was introduced into the gas phase pipeline of the first water washing tank 1 through the gas phase outlet of the reaction equipment, the gas phase was flushed into the dilute ammonia water from the pipeline outlet (located 300 mm below the dilute ammonia water liquid level), the hydrogen oxide calcium dust was fully contacted with the dilute ammonia water and was adsorbed; at the same time, the sawtooth-shaped broken structure 4 of the pipeline outlet broke the bubbles generated by the gas phase in time to prevent the bubbles from carrying the unadsorbed dust escaping. After the two-stage water washing, the gas phase was introduced into the second water washing tank 2 through the gas phase pipeline, the gas phase pipeline outlet in the second water washing tank 2 was also inserted into the dilute ammonia water liquid level below 300 mm, and the gas phase was flushed into the dilute ammonia water again for secondary purification to further remove the residual hydrogen oxide calcium dust. The gas phase after completing the two-stage water washing was then introduced into the mist eliminator 3, a layer of 100 mm metal mesh demister was arranged in the mist eliminator 3, the water mist in the gas phase was intercepted by the metal mesh to realize gas-liquid separation, and the gas phase after removing the water mist was introduced into the vacuum system.

[0033] During the entire operation process, the liquid level meters 10 of the first water washing tank 1, the second water washing tank 2, the mist eliminator 3 and the temporary storage tank 7 transmitted the liquid level data to the control system in real time. When the liquid level in the first water washing tank 1 or the second water washing tank 2 slightly rose to the upper limit due to dust adsorption, the control system immediately interlocked to open the on-off valve 9 on the balance gas pipeline 8, the vacuum was broken through the connection of the balance gas pipeline 8, the liquid level decreased, and when the liquid level decreased to below the upper limit, the on-off valve 9 was automatically closed, and the vacuum state in the first water washing tank 1 or the second water washing tank 2 was restored; if the liquid level in the first water washing tank 1 or the second water washing tank 2 decreased to the lower limit, the control system interlocked to open the corresponding on-off valve 11 of the first water washing tank 1 or the second water washing tank 2, and after the dilute ammonia water was supplemented to the preset liquid level, the on-off valve 11 was closed. The operator regularly observed the state of the dilute ammonia water in the first water washing tank 1 and the second water washing tank 2 through the sight glasses, when the dilute ammonia water was found to be a suspension and the adsorption capacity decreased, the suspension was discharged to the temporary storage tank 7 through the discharge port, and then new dilute ammonia water was injected. When the liquid level meter 10 of the temporary storage tank 7 monitored that the liquid level reached the upper limit, the delivery pump 12 of the temporary storage tank 7 outlet was started to deliver the temporarily stored dilute ammonia water containing dust to the downstream recovery section for recycling.
